Democrats held a primary debate in New York City last night. They had no choice. Both the candidates in this race are incumbents. Thanks to a court decision that redrew congressional boundaries, the two most powerful members of the New York delegation are now running against each other for the same seat. That’s a lot of fun. For 30 years, Carolyn Maloney has represented the Upper East Side of Manhattan. Over the same period, 30 years, Jerry Nadler has represented the Upper West Side of Manhattan. Jerry Nadler is 75 years old. Carolyn Maloney is 76 years old. Rather than do the obvious thing and retire, the two are now competing for the newly drawn 12th Congressional District that will combine the Upper East Side and the Upper West Sides of Manhattan. 

It turns out to be the richest district in American politics. Four of the Democratic Party’s five top fundraising zip codes are within this district’s boundaries.
